Buying at garage sales
A garage sale is a great way to save money if you're trying to keep your budget in check. Garage sales can be a great place for camping gear or winter coats. Also, look out for winter accessories such thick gloves and scarves. Most people sell their clothes at a dirt cheap price so winter accessories can be found for only a few dollars. You can save money by buying pre-loved clothing.

How to deal with a wound during survival situations
What should you do in case you get hurt? First, you need to know how to heal your wound. You need to learn how to stop bleeding and clean the wounds. Then you must try to prevent the infection from spreading. You should consult a doctor if the wound becomes too large.

You can clean the wound by washing it with warm water and soap. You should then apply an antiseptic lotion. The wound should be covered with a bandage. Bandaging helps keep the wound dry and prevents it from becoming infected.
After applying the bandage, you should check the wound every day. It is important to remove the bandage when it becomes dirty. It can lead to infections.
